Nature Reserve of Capo Gallo

A real hidden paradise easily reached with a few minutes walk from Mondello, Capo Gallo is a regional nature reserve encompassing the huge Mount Gallo, ending up in a rocky promontory towered by a lighthouse, some grottos, and hidden sandy beaches surrounded by wild vegetation. Among its inhabitants are falcons, buzzards, and owls, while the reserve beckons adventurers with opportunities for snorkelling, kayaking, and hiking adventures.

Thanks to its rich and varied history, Palermo and its surrounding areas are full of architectural treasures just waiting to be discovered. Many of the sights are conveniently situated in the city centre: in the Old Town, you'll find treasures like Palazzo dei Normanni, as well as the beautiful Santa Caterina Church, and the spectacular Piazza Pretoria. For a getaway from the hustle and bustle of the city, the beautiful volcanic island of Ustica is a safe bet and will not disappoint you.
